The opportunity
Join our dynamic Engineering team in Regional Center of Competence, Europe Hub, as a Project Manager Engineering and lead technically the execution and tendering of cutting-edge eMobility electric power supply infrastructure projects—including DC charging solutions for electric buses. You’ll shape technical solutions, lead engineering efforts across MV & LV distribution systems and power conversion equipment and collaborate with internal and external stakeholders to drive innovation and excellence. If you're passionate about sustainable mobility and thrive in a fast-paced, collaborative environment, this is your chance to make a real impact.
How you’ll make an impact
Take technical lead in execution and tendering of eMobility electrical infrastructure projects (e.g., bus depots, terminal charging stations), support and guide Local execution and tendering teams
Own all engineering activities across project lifecycles—from concept to commissioning
Collaborate internally with Local Operating Units responsible for project execution and tendering, Sales, R&D, Product engineers, Supply chain, Site Installation & Commissioning teams and externally with customers, suppliers
Coordinate and supervise remote engineering teams for primary and secondary engineering tasks as applicable
Design power supply system architectures, perform sizing calculations, and prepare technical specifications
Evaluate supplier offers and support procurement processes with Supply Chain Management
Provide technical expertise during tendering and project execution phases
Translate customer requirements into optimized, compliant technical solutions
Lead technical discussions with clients, resolve site queries, and ensure timely, high-quality deliverables
Ensure safety, compliance, and engineering excellence throughout the project
Your background
Bachelor’s or master’s degree in electrical engineering, with a focus on Power Electronics or Power Systems
7–10 years of experience in MV/LV power distribution systems, electrical systems design & engineering
Experience with DC power supply systems, power converters, energy storage, or harmonic filtering is a plus
Strong knowledge of engineering tools and software (e.g., BIM, CAD, ETAP, MathCAD)
Proactive, results-driven mindset with strong teamwork and communication skills
Committed to safety, quality, and continuous learning
Willingness to travel up to 10% for customer and project meetings
Fluent in English and French
